        Caught this Dorado on a handline, offshore Angola. These are great fun to catch, as they don't half put up a fight! I think it weighed in at +/-25lbs. The fillets were rubbed with Cajun spices, & blackened on the hot-plate within 45 mins of pulling it out the water. I've yet to encounter a better tasting fish than the Dorado, (aka Mahi Mahi/Dolphin Fish/Lampuka).

            About 15 feet below on the next deck, which is about 20 feet above the water. The trick is to get the fish to surface and have its head out of the water, it just stops fighting then. Made a 3-prong gaff out of 8" welded u-bolts with the ends grinded to a point. Looks like a huge treble hook. Splice some 0.5" manilla rope around the welded eye. Then put a spring-loaded caribina through the manilla about 3 feet above the eye of the gaff. That way you can clip the caribina to your line and run it down straight under the fish, and then give it a good yank!
